2 Lectures Plan

7/6/99


Click here to start


Table of Contents

PPT Slide

2 Lectures Plan

From 2-tier to 3-tier Architectures

From Client-Server to Multi-Server (Distributed) and Multi-Client (Collab)

5 Nested Granularity Levels

3 Architectural Perspectives

Base Concepts

Base Concepts : High Performance Commodity Computing

Base Concepts: Pragmatic Object Web

POW Technologies

POW Technologies: WebFlow

WebFlow Overview

WebFlow HPC Architecture

PPT Slide

WebFlow Front-End & Middlware

WebFlow Middleware & Backend

WebFlow - Demo Snapshots

WebFlow SC’97 Demo

WebFlow Next Steps

POW Technologies: JWORB (Java Web Object Request Broker)

JWORB Overview

Complex Internet system

WebFlow Server

Towards Pragmatic Object Web Servers

CORBA - Common Object Request Broker Architecture

CORBA - Common Object Request Broker Architecture

Summer ‘97: Early JWORB Concepts

PPT Slide

JWORB Next Steps

POW Technologies: Object Web RTI (Run-Time Infrastructure)

OWRTI Overview

OWRTI Overview (cont)

DMSO HLA/RTI

RTI 1.0

Run-Time Infrastructure Provides Six Categories of Services

RTI Time Management

PPT Slide

PPT Slide

POW Techs: Object Web RTI

Object Web RTI Architecture

PPT Slide

POW Technologies: WebHLA

WebHLA Overview

WebHLA as Integration Platform

PPT Slide

WebHLA as 3-Tier Architecture

WebHLA based Simulation Based Acquisition

WebHLA Components

WebHLA Components: JWORB, OWRTI, WebFlow Authoring, DirectX Front-Ends

WebHLA Demos

PPT Slide

PPT Slide

Direct X Framework

PPT Slide

WebHLA Application: Parallel => Metacomputing CMS

Parallel => Metacomputing CMS: Milestones and Current Status

PPT Slide

PPT Slide

Architecture of WebHLA based Parallel CMS

PPT Slide

PPT Slide

PPT Slide

PPT Slide

JDIS and PDUDB Front-End

JDIS - DIS/HLA Bridge & I/O in Java

PPT Slide

Parallel => Metacomputing CMS: List of Components / Federates

WebHLA based Cluster Management

WebHLA - Planning Parallel & Distributed RTI - Ultimate Scenario

PPT Slide

SPEEDES

WebHLA based SPEEDES Training

WebHLA Next Steps

WebHLA - Potential Markets

POW Next Steps

Towards (Extended) UML based WebFlow

Need for Multiple-View Modeling

UML Views, Models and Diagrams

Use Case Diagram

Class Diagram

Object Diagram

Deployment Diagram

Sequence Diagram

Collaboration Diagram

Statechart Diagram

Activity Diagram

Component Diagram

Current UML Products and Related Standards

UML Metamodel: Foundation/Core

UML Metamodel: Foundation/Extension

UML Metamodel: Behavior/Common

Strategy for POW Authoring

Standard UML Class Diagrams: SPEEDES Example

Extended UML Class Diagrams: SPEEDES Example

Standard UML Sequence Diagrams: SPEEDES Example

Extended UML Sequence Diagrams: SPEEDES Example

Standard UML Activity Diagrams: SPEEDES Example

Extended UML Activity Diagrams: SPEEDES Example

Author:

Email: gcf@npac.syr.edu

Home Page: http://www.npac.syr.edu